Fiscal Impact/Change to Net County Cost: Funding for year-3, July 1, 2006 through June 30, 2007, is increased from $24,277 to $129,150 with additional funding of $104,873. This funding was known and added to the budget in September. There is no Net County Cost.

 

Background: Each year, the State of California issues AIDS Program funding to California counties to continue their work preventing, counseling, testing, and tracking HIV/AIDS.  The documents include a Master Grant, which describes the terms/conditions and reimbursement/reporting procedures, and individual MOU's for each program being supported by the Grant that describe, in detail, the scope of work for that particular program. 

 

Reason for Recommendation: The State is providing additional funding in FY 2006-07 to support an expansion of services for the HIV Prevention Program.  These amendments are retroactive to July 1, 2006 due to late receipt of documents from the State.
